Important information for health care professionals and facilities Enhanced claimslink App Replacing Other Online Options Coming Soon: ReferralLink and Claims Submission Apps We re introducing a new app on Link, your gateway to UnitedHealthcare s online tools. claimslink has enhanced features and an easy-to-use design developed with feedback from Link users. With claimslink, you can: In addition to claimslink, two brand new apps will be launching soon. referrallink will combine the referral functionality from the retired Eligibility & Benefits app and UnitedHealthcareOnline.com. It also will allow you to copy a referral so you don t need to enter all the same information again. The app initially will be available for UnitedHealthcare Commercial and UnitedHealthcare Medicare Solutions plan members. View claims information for multiple UnitedHealthcare plans Submit additional information requested on pended claims New! Create your own claims view by selecting which information is displayed New! View claims history timeline New! Create a new claim reconsideration request or view an existing one from the claim detail screen New! Switch to the eligibilitylink app without re-entering member information claimslink will replace our other online options for obtaining claims information: Claim Status and Claim Reconsideration on UnitedHealthcareOnline.com and the Claims Management and Claims Reconsideration apps on Link. The Claims Submission app initially will allow you to submit individual institutional claims with attachments to UnitedHealthcare. Our payer-specific editing rules will be applied to these claim submissions to quickly alert you of any errors. This app will be ideal for users who don t have an electronic data interchange (EDI) vendor. If you have questions, please call the UnitedHealthcare Connectivity Help Desk at 866-842-3278, option 3, 7 a.m. 9 p.m. Central Time, Monday through Friday. The claimslink launch has begun and will continue through June. Your transition to claimslink will work the same way as the transition to eligibilitylink did users will have pop-up boxes to try claimslink for about three weeks before the transactions are removed from UnitedHealthcareOnline.com. Please watch your inbox because we ll send you an email with instructions when claimslink is available to you. Important information for health care professionals and facilities Communication Between PCPs and Specialists Is Key to Well-Coordinated Care Primary care physicians (PCPs) and specialists have shared responsibility for coordinating care and communicating essential patient information to each other. Lack of communication can negatively affect quality patient care. Relevant information from the PCP to the specialist should include the patient s history, diagnostic tests and results, and the reason for referring the member to the specialist for a consultation. The specialist is responsible for timely communication of the results of consultations to the PCP, and ongoing recommendations and treatment plans. Well-coordinated care starts with a regular exchange of information between health care providers to give the patient the highest quality care and care management. Fighting Homelessness in Nebraska Helping Members in a Housing Crisis Every night, 20,000 people are homeless in Nebraska. The average age of a homeless person? Nine. 1 These people sleep on the streets, in shelters, or move from couch to couch. Still others spend so much of their income on rent that they lack money for food, medicine, gas, adequate heat or air conditioning. UnitedHealthcare Community Plan of Nebraska is fighting back for our members by working with several local organizations focused on affordable housing and help for the homeless. We know members can t focus on staying well, managing chronic illness or living independently when they don t have access to safe, affordable housing. That s why Our Housing Navigator is available to make sure members have access to the services they need. If you are working with UnitedHealthcare Community Plan members who are experiencing a housing crisis, our Housing Navigator can help them navigate available resources to resolve their residential issues and receive appropriate medical care. Update: Radiology Prior Authorization No Longer Required Effective March 1, 2017, UnitedHealthcare Community Plan of Nebraska will not require prior authorization for radiology services.
